Cathy Zbanek, the Chief Synergy Officer at TFS Financial Corporation, recently sold a significant chunk of her holdings in the company. On June 15, 2026, she offloaded 61,334 shares at an average price of $16.92 each. This transaction was valued at approximately $1.04 million. Unlike some insider trades, this sale was not part of a pre-planned trading program.

Insider Buying and Selling at TFS Financial Corporation

In addition to Cathy Zbanek's sale, she also bought 67,500 shares at $14.74 each on the same day, indicating a complex trading strategy. Meredith Weil, the Chief Financial Officer, was also active, selling 45,684 shares at $16.80 each on June 11, 2026, and buying 50,000 shares at $14.74 each.

About TFS Financial Corporation

TFS Financial Corporation, head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, is a regional bank providing a range of consumer banking services in the United States. It offers deposit accounts, mortgage loans, and other financial products through its subsidiary, Third Federal Savings and Loan Association. Founded in 1938, the company is led by CEO Marc A. Stefanski and employs about 958 people.
